Quote:
Originally Posted by methyl
What you ask is not possible from unix "lp" commands. Once the job has left the unix print queue it has gone.

In this case you'll need to cancel the job on the printer itself ... or from the print server software if it is actually a print server.
very good how can i cancel the job from the printer it self as you said ? same like " clear printer buffer"
# 9  
Old 06-15-2010
That will be on the printer itself either by its menu or key/button (like laserjet4000 red-pink button : "Cancel Job") or turn off the printer and bring it back up agin...
